Subject: [PATCH] mdio_bus: Issue GPIO RESET to PHYs.
|
||||
|
||||
Some boards [1] leave the PHYs at an invalid state
|
||||
during system power-up or reset thus causing unreliability
|
||||
issues with the PHY which manifests as PHY not being detected
|
||||
or link not functional. To fix this, these PHYs need to be RESET
|
||||
via a GPIO connected to the PHY's RESET pin.
|
||||
|
||||
Some boards have a single GPIO controlling the PHY RESET pin of all
|
||||
PHYs on the bus whereas some others have separate GPIOs controlling
|
||||
individual PHY RESETs.
|
||||
|
||||
In both cases, the RESET de-assertion cannot be done in the PHY driver
|
||||
as the PHY will not probe till its reset is de-asserted.
|
||||
So do the RESET de-assertion in the MDIO bus driver.
|
||||
|
||||
[1] - am572x-idk, am571x-idk, a437x-idk

+Common MDIO bus properties.
|
||||
+
|
||||
+These are generic properties that can apply to any MDIO bus.
|
||||
+
|
||||
+Optional properties:
|
||||
+- reset-gpios: List of one or more GPIOs that control the RESET lines
|
||||
+ of the PHYs on that MDIO bus.
|
||||
+- reset-delay-us: RESET pulse width in microseconds as per PHY datasheet.
|
||||
+
|
||||
+A list of child nodes, one per device on the bus is expected. These
|
||||
+should follow the generic phy.txt, or a device specific binding document.
|
||||
+
|
||||
+Example :
|
||||
+This example shows these optional properties, plus other properties
|
||||
+required for the TI Davinci MDIO driver.
|
||||
+
|
||||
+ davinci_mdio: ethernet@0x5c030000 {
|
||||
+ compatible = "ti,davinci_mdio";
|
||||
+ reg = <0x5c030000 0x1000>;
|
||||
+ #address-cells = <1>;
|
||||
+ #size-cells = <0>;
|
||||
+
|
||||
+ reset-gpios = <&gpio2 5 GPIO_ACTIVE_LOW>;
|
||||
+ reset-delay-us = <2>; /* PHY datasheet states 1us min */
|
||||
+
|
||||
+ ethphy0: ethernet-phy@1 {
|
||||
+ reg = <1>;
|
||||
+ };
|
||||
+
|
||||
+ ethphy1: ethernet-phy@3 {
|
||||
+ reg = <3>;
|
||||
+ };
|
||||
+ };

Subject: [PATCH] net: phy: Call bus->reset() after releasing PHYs from reset
|
||||
|
||||
The API convention makes it that a given MDIO bus reset should be able
|
||||
to access PHY devices in its reset() callback and perform additional
|
||||
MDIO accesses in order to bring the bus and PHYs in a working state.
|
||||
|
||||
Commit 69226896ad63 ("mdio_bus: Issue GPIO RESET to PHYs.") broke that
|
||||
contract by first calling bus->reset() and then release all PHYs from
|
||||
reset using their shared GPIO line, so restore the expected
|
||||
functionality here.
|
||||
|
||||
Fixes: 69226896ad63 ("mdio_bus: Issue GPIO RESET to PHYs.")

Subject: [PATCH] mdio_bus: handle only single PHY reset GPIO
|
||||
|
||||
Commit 4c5e7a2c0501 ("dt-bindings: mdio: Clarify binding document")
|
||||
declared that a MDIO reset GPIO property should have only a single GPIO
|
||||
reference/specifier, however the supporting code was left intact, still
|
||||
burdening the kernel with now apparently useless loops -- get rid of them.

Subject: [PATCH] mdio_bus: use devm_gpiod_get_optional()
|
||||
|
||||
The MDIO reset GPIO is really a classical optional GPIO property case,
|
||||
so devm_gpiod_get_optional() should have been used, not devm_gpiod_get().
|
||||
Doing this saves several LoCs...
